WebAugmentative and Alternative Communication (AAC) is an umbrella term to describe any communication device, strategy, or system that supports or replaces natural spoken speech. Augmentative means to support or supplement, adding extra to speech like a picture, writing, or gestures. Alternative means to use instead of speech. WebTo communicate, children with Down syndrome may point, reach, wave, blow kisses, show, put their hands up, or push things away. Gestures aid in comprehension and expression in children with Down syndrome and are often associated with later comprehension and vocabulary development. Bobby was two years 10 months old when he was first seen. At that time he had poor verbal imitative skills, poor oral-motor control, had not gone through the typical babbling stage, had no consonant sounds but a few vowels, and was essentially nonverbal.
